Legality

Are BB guns legal to carry in your car? That depends on the laws of your state of residence; some consider them toys and exempt them from firearm regulations, while others think them powder-propelled weapons that require code. It’s always wise to follow local laws in order to avoid being charged with violating them and incurring fines or criminal charges.

If police officers stop your car while driving and see an air-powered gun in it, they may assume it to be accurate and arrest you for possessing one. Therefore, your BB gun must be stored safely within its case in the trunk – this will protect it from falling into criminal hands or accidental use by anyone other than intended and provide law enforcement officials with clarity as to its purpose. Ideally, its case would also indicate its nature to avoid confusion from them.

Some individuals may be unaware that carrying a BB gun in public can actually be illegal. California penalizes the public display of imitation firearms – including BB guns – while they’re often prohibited within school zones or around children.

New Jersey law classifies BB guns as restricted firearms and requires you to obtain a permit before carrying them openly on public streets unless you are an active member of either law enforcement or military, making storage a crucial consideration. It is advised to store your gun securely inside its locked container within the trunk of your car while keeping ammunition separately tucked away from its contents.

While BB guns may seem harmless when used only for target practice and recreational shooting, they can become deadly weapons if misused to threaten or injure someone. In Colorado, for instance, any act that places another in fear of severe bodily harm using any weapon that reasonably appears lethal – including waving one in their face – constitutes criminal conduct, including brandishing one to threaten someone with.

Safety

Though BB guns and airsoft weapons may seem harmless enough, they can still pose a danger to people or animals, not to mention potentially being used to commit crimes. If you plan on keeping one in your car, make sure that safe shooting practices are employed and only use it for its intended use – also, always lock it securely in your vehicle when not being used.

BB guns can be highly hazardous when shot from close range. Although most accidents do not result in severe or life-threatening injuries, it is still essential to take all necessary precautions when using them. When shooting at a range, make sure the owner approves of your BB gun before bringing it in; or when traveling by car, make sure it stays safely out of reach from passengers and drivers by keeping it stored safely away in your trunk and out of sight of passengers and drivers.

Many BB guns are designed to look as realistic as possible, simulating real firearms both visually and audibly. Unfortunately, this can be dangerous when police officers become involved – Austin ISD Police recently shared an image of one of their confiscated BB weapons to remind people that these weapons can be very lethal in high-stakes situations.

Though small in size, BB guns and airsoft weapons are sometimes misidentified by law enforcement as actual firearms. This can become problematic during routine traffic stops when law enforcement sees such weapons in your hand or under your seat; an officer could then treat it as a firearm and bring criminal charges against you for possessing one.

Most states have laws that set restrictions on who may own and carry airguns, such as BB guns. These restrictions can vary widely and depend on factors like your age, conviction status, or military or law enforcement service status. Before purchasing or carrying an airgun in any form, it’s wise to familiarise yourself with your state’s gun laws first; otherwise, if in doubt regarding legal ownership/carry restrictions, consult an attorney.
